keskkonnaproove
Keskkonnaproove refers to samples collected from the environment for analytical purposes. These samples can include air, water, soil, sediment, or biota, such as plants and animals. The primary goal of collecting keskkonnaproove is to assess the presence, concentration, and distribution of various substances, including pollutants, nutrients, and microorganisms. This data is crucial for understanding environmental conditions, identifying potential risks to human health and ecosystems, and monitoring the effectiveness of environmental protection measures.
